How to disable S-VOICE and get GOOGLE NOW with double click of home button?

Great question. I did this and love it.
Download Home2 Share and follow directions.

You will be choosing Voice search as the app in the configuration, not google voice (Voice search is the name of the google component).
Make sure you go to s voice and turn off the S voice connection to the home button.

1. Where is the option to turn off S voice?

Thanks.
 
I did two things.

first, load s voice (double tap home)
click menu button, then in those options you can unclick the "use home button for s voice"
next go to applications manager and disable it altogether.
